Swoop Group Tours to Patagonia: FAQs
-
Are flights included?
Prices exclude international flights and domestic flights to the starting point of the trip. If you prefer, Swoop can also help book these for you, or we can recommend the best flights to connect with the start and end of your tour.
-
What is the group size?
All our group tours have a maximum size of 16 travellers, except for The W Trek (6 days) which has a maximum of 12 travellers. We intentionally keep all departures small to create a more personal and immersive experience.
-
Are departures guaranteed?
Yes, all Swoop group tours departures are guaranteed.
-
Is there a supplement for solo travellers?
All our group tours are based on two people sharing accommodation. They attract like-minded travellers from around the world, so solo travellers will be matched with someone of the same sex to share a room.
If you prefer to guarantee a single room, a single-supplement is available for all trips, except for trips that include Refugio nights on the W-trek.
-
How active are the tours?
We have two styles of departure: Gentle and Active. Our gentle tours travel at a relaxed pace, with short easy walks and plenty of time to let the destination unfold around you. Our Active tours are slightly faster paced for travellers who want to squeeze in more activities and longer and slightly more testing day hikes.
-
What type of accommodation do the tours use?
The exact accommodation depending on the trip style. Our more gentle adventures stay in superior accommodation through out, while our active tours stay in simpler (but still comfortable) accommodation. Trips that include the W Trek also stay in refugios or campsites, according to the itinerary.
-
What time of year do the trips operate?
All our group tours operate between November and March, during the summer months of the Southern hemisphere, and the peak time for travel in Patagonia.
